用c语言编程遵循什么顺序

worktile 其他 3

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在使用C语言编程时,遵循以下顺序可以帮助你更好地组织代码并提高编程效率:

    1. 引入头文件:在开始编写代码之前,通常会引入所需的头文件。头文件中包含了函数声明、常量定义、结构体定义等信息,以供后续代码使用。

    2. 定义宏常量:在编程过程中,经常会使用一些固定的常量。通过定义宏常量,可以使代码更加清晰易读,并方便后续的维护和修改。

    3. 定义全局变量:全局变量在整个程序中都可以被访问,因此在程序开始时定义全局变量是一个常见的做法。全局变量的定义应放在函数之外,以便于其他函数的访问和使用。

    4. 函数声明:在主函数之前,通常会先声明所需的函数。函数声明告诉编译器函数的存在和函数的参数、返回值等信息,以便编译器在使用函数时能够正确地解析和调用。

    5. 主函数:主函数是程序的入口,它是C程序执行的起点。在主函数中,可以进行变量的定义、函数的调用、流程控制等操作。主函数通常包含一个返回值,用于告诉操作系统程序的运行结果。

    6. 定义局部变量:在函数中,我们常常需要定义一些局部变量来存储临时数据。局部变量的作用域仅限于其所在的函数内部,在函数执行完毕后会被自动销毁。

    7. 编写函数体:在函数的定义中,编写函数体是最重要的一步。函数体中包含了具体的实现代码,用于完成特定的功能。在函数体中可以使用变量、运算符、控制语句等来实现所需的逻辑。

    8. 函数调用:在需要使用函数的地方,可以通过函数调用来执行函数体中的代码。函数调用可以传递参数,以便函数能够处理不同的数据。通过函数调用,可以实现代码的模块化和重复利用。

    9. 编译和调试:完成代码编写后,需要进行编译和调试以确保程序的正确性。编译将源代码转换为机器码,调试则是通过运行程序并逐步跟踪代码的执行过程,以发现和修复错误。

    10. 注释和文档:在编写代码时,合理地添加注释可以提高代码的可读性和可维护性。注释可以解释代码的功能、实现思路、参数说明等信息,便于其他开发人员理解和修改代码。此外,还可以编写代码文档,对程序进行更详细的说明。

    以上是使用C语言编程时遵循的一般顺序,但实际编程过程中可能会因项目的不同而有所变化。不过,遵循良好的编程习惯和规范,能够使代码更加清晰、易读和易于维护。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在使用C语言编程时,可以遵循以下顺序来进行开发:

    1. 需求分析和设计:在开始编程之前,需要明确程序的需求和目标。这包括确定程序的功能、输入输出的格式、算法和数据结构等。可以使用流程图、伪代码或者UML图等工具来进行需求分析和设计。

    2. 编写算法和逻辑:根据需求分析和设计的结果,开始编写程序的算法和逻辑。可以使用伪代码来描述算法的步骤,然后再将其转化为C语言的语法。

    3. 编写代码:根据算法和逻辑,使用C语言编写程序代码。可以使用文本编辑器或者集成开发环境(IDE)来编写代码。在编写代码时,需要注意代码的可读性和规范性,使用合适的变量名和注释,遵循代码风格的规范。

    4. 编译和调试:编写完代码后,需要使用C语言的编译器将源代码转换为可执行文件。在编译过程中,会检查代码中的语法错误和逻辑错误。如果编译出现错误,需要进行调试和修复。可以使用调试器来定位和解决问题。

    5. 测试和优化:在编译和调试成功后,需要进行程序的测试。可以使用不同的测试用例来验证程序的正确性和性能。如果发现问题,需要进行调试和修复。同时,还可以对程序进行优化,提高程序的性能和效率。

    6. 文档撰写和维护:在完成程序开发后,需要撰写程序的文档。文档可以包括程序的使用说明、算法和逻辑的描述、代码的注释等。同时,还需要对程序进行维护,修复bug和添加新功能。

    总结:使用C语言编程时,可以按照需求分析和设计、编写算法和逻辑、编写代码、编译和调试、测试和优化、文档撰写和维护的顺序进行开发。这样可以有序地完成程序的开发工作,并确保程序的正确性和可维护性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在使用C语言编程时,可以遵循以下顺序:

    1. 引入头文件:在程序的开头,我们通常需要引入所需的头文件。头文件包含了函数的声明、宏定义以及结构体的定义等。通过引入头文件,我们可以使用其中定义的函数和宏等。

    2. 定义常量和全局变量:在程序的开头,可以定义一些常量和全局变量。常量是固定不变的值,而全局变量是在整个程序中都可访问的变量。

    3. 定义函数:在主函数(main函数)之前,可以定义其他的函数。函数是一个独立的代码块,用于执行特定的任务。函数可以提高代码的可读性和复用性。

    4. 主函数(main函数):程序的执行从主函数开始。主函数是C程序的入口点,程序从主函数开始执行,并按照顺序逐行执行主函数中的代码。

    5. 输入和输出:在主函数中,我们可以使用输入和输出函数来与用户进行交互。输入函数可以从键盘获取用户输入的数据,输出函数可以将结果显示在屏幕上。

    6. 算术运算和逻辑运算:C语言提供了一系列的算术运算符和逻辑运算符,可以对数据进行各种计算和判断。

    7. 控制语句:控制语句用于控制程序的流程。常见的控制语句包括条件语句(if-else语句和switch语句)和循环语句(while循环、for循环和do-while循环)。

    8. 数组和指针:数组是一组相同类型的数据的集合,可以通过下标访问其中的元素。指针是存储内存地址的变量,可以通过指针间接访问和修改内存中的数据。

    9. 结构体和联合体:结构体是一种自定义的数据类型,可以将多个不同类型的数据组合在一起。联合体是一种特殊的结构体,不同的成员共享同一块内存。

    10. 文件操作:C语言提供了一些函数用于文件的读写操作。可以使用这些函数来读取文件中的数据,或者将数据写入文件中。

    11. 动态内存分配:在程序运行过程中,有时需要动态地分配内存来存储数据。C语言提供了一些函数用于动态内存分配,如malloc、calloc和realloc等。

    12. 错误处理:在程序运行过程中,可能会出现各种错误。为了增强程序的健壮性,我们需要对可能出现的错误进行处理,如使用错误处理函数和异常处理机制等。

    13. 清理资源:在程序执行完毕后,需要对使用的资源进行清理和释放,以防止资源泄露。可以使用一些函数来释放动态分配的内存、关闭文件等。

    以上是使用C语言编程时可以遵循的一般顺序,具体的编程流程还会受到具体项目的要求和个人的编程习惯等因素的影响。在实际编程中,可以根据需要进行灵活调整。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部